Saraki, Dogara in London to see President
The Senate President and Speaker of the House are leading a delegation to see President Muhammadu Buhari in London

Buhari embarked on a 10-day vacation on January 19 and sought an extension on February 5.
The Presidency has said that the extension was inevitable because the President was waiting to receive results of his medical tests from Doctors.
The President met with APC Leaders Bola Tinubu and Bisi Akande last week and had phone conversations with both leaders of parliament two weeks ago.
The President has also hosted Ogun State Governor Ibikunle Amosun and his cousin, Mamman Daura.
Other principal officers of the national assembly are also in the delegation to see the President today.
"Saraki, Dogara, Lasun and Ahmed Lawan are in London", Saraki's media aide, Bamikole Omishore who is also in London, told Pulse.
Omishore however declined revealing the time and venue of the meeting.
